Course Purpose
The purpose of the American Red Cross r. 24 Lifeguarding Instructor course is to train instructor candidates to teach the basic-level courses in the American Red Cross Lifeguarding program.
Course Prerequisites
? Be at least 17 years old on or before the final scheduled session of the Lifeguarding Instructor course.
? Possess a current basic-level certification in American Red Cross Lifeguarding (Including Deep Water) with CPR/AED for Professional Rescuers and First Aid. (Note: r.17 Lifeguarding certification accepted)
? Successfully complete the online session of the Lifeguarding Instructor course prior to the
precourse session.
? Successfully complete the prerequisite skill assessment scenario to continue in the course. The prerequisite skill assessment scenario evaluates the following skills:
o Entry
o Swimming approach
o Surface dive in deep water (7 to 10 feet)
o Passive submerged rescue
o Rapid extrication (with an assisting rescuer)
o Rapid assessment
o Single-rescuer CPR (3 minutes)
